Overview
Objectives:
The main aim of the project is to create a genetic database of selected species of mammals to be used for evaluation of landscape fragmentation in the Czech Republic. When constructing new roads or reconstructing the existing ones, this database will be used to evaluate the degree of fragmentation based on genetics in order to propose adequate measures to secure permeability of the area (design of wildlife crossings etc.). It is an innovative method with positive impacts on the cost-effectiveness and the environment.
